What's referred to as the "going and coming regulation" indicates that normal workday travel, driving to and from the work environment, is not covered by workers' comp in the majority of states. If an accident happens throughout such traveling and an employee is wounded, she or he would certainly not be made up for those injuries.
This consists of staff members running a task for their employer, like visiting the article workplace, leaving paperwork with a customer or getting a cake for a company party, unless the staff member deviated for their very own task or benefit. One of the most common locations for employee injuries outside the work environment are sidewalks, sidewalks and parking area.
Workers' compensation will cover injuries that take place within the program and scope of work. If a worker is injured outside the training course and scope of their employement and is not able to function while they recoup, they may be eligible for Family members Medical Leave Act (12 weeks of unpaid leave), temporary disability or long-term impairment.
Some firms may be able to offer alternative obligations while the staff member recoups. Talk to your employer or Human resources rep to understand your alternatives.

Due to the fact that many mishaps and injuries occur at the work environment or while an individual is acting on part of their employer, the inquiry frequently emerges as to the difference between an employees compensation and an injury insurance claim under The golden state regulation.
If an employee endures an "commercial injury", she or he may be entitled to receive benefits for that injury or injuries through the California workers settlement system. An "industrial injury" is an injury endured during the training course and extent of their employment (i.e. while doing a task for their employer or at their company's direction).
It is not only feasible however, takes place more regularly than one could think. There are many common circumstances where an individual might be harmed on the job but, the injury might be triggered by the negligence of a person or entity not straight linked with their employer. These circumstances include the following:Defective products consisting of industrial machinery not made by the employer.Car mishapsor truck accidents or heavy devices mishaps with forklifts or comparable lorries, when brought on by a person not connected with the employer even if it happens while the employee is working, qualifies the wounded individual to both workers compensation advantages from their company and a full accident case against the at-fault driver or their company.

The general guideline with occupational auto crashes is that your employer has to cover your clinical costs after an accident unless you were driving to or from work. This principle is called the Going and Coming Regulation. This suggests you normally can not assert workers' settlement benefits if the automobile crash happened during your everyday commute to or from your job.
As long as the mishap happened on business residential or commercial property or as component of a work-related task, you should get approved for workers' settlement advantages. Any type of clinical bills associated with your injuries in an automobile crash while at work need to be totally covered by workers' compensation. If you miss work because of your injuries, the workers' payment wage-replacement benefits will cover up to two-thirds of your typical once a week earnings, as set by state regulation.
Independent professionals (however recognize that several companies attempt to improperly label employees as independent specialists) Laid-back workers Agricultural employees Railway employees Federal government staff members operating in the state Some owner-operator truck vehicle drivers In South Carolina, workers' settlement is a no-fault benefit. This indicates that it does not matter that triggered the car crash, as long as it took place throughout a job-related task or on firm home.

Effective October 1, 2012, asserts for employees' compensation must be submitted online utilizing the Workers' Compensation Procedures and Monitoring Website (ECOMP).
You should also contact your Employees' Settlement Professional for assistance before getting started with ECOMP. You ought to report all occupational problems to your manager and submit the Form CA-1 or Type CA-2, even if there is no lost time or clinical cost.
In several instances, several of the blocks on Forms CA-1 and CA-2 will certainly not put on your scenario. Instead than leave them blank (which will lead to them being gone back to you and postponing your claim), indicate not applicable or "N/A". All documents relevant to your employees' payment should be digitally uploaded and sent throughout the ECOMP initiation of the claim.
